Ten post opisuje:
Jakie jest znaczenie polecenia „Git Reset” wraz z opcją „-Hard” i „Origin/Master”?
„„Git Reset -Hard Origin/Master”Można użyć do etapu i niezbędnych zmian. Usuwa wszystkie zmiany wprowadzone w bieżącej gałęzi lokalnej, dzięki czemu jest taka sama jak pochodzenie/mistrz, i zresetuj wskaźnik głowy.
W jaki sposób polecenie „Git Reset” wraz z opcją „-Hard” i „Origin/Master” działa?
Aby wyświetlić działanie wcześniej omawianego polecenia, najpierw przejdź do lokalnego repozytorium GIT i utwórz nowy plik w lokalnym repozytorium. Śledź nowe pliki w strefie inscenizacji i popełnij zmiany. Następnie sprawdź historię dziennika referencyjnego GIT i wyświetl listę istniejących zdalnych adresów URL. Następnie pobierz zaktualizowaną kopię zdalnego repozytorium i uruchom „$ git reset -Hard pochodzenie/master" Komenda.
Teraz wdrożyć wyżej wymyślone instrukcje!
Krok 1: Przejdź do pożądanego lokalnego repozytorium GIT
Przejdź do żądanego repozytorium GIT, wykonując „płyta CD" Komenda:
$ cd "c: \ Users \ nazma \ git \ test_10"Krok 2: Utwórz plik lokalny
Wykonaj „dotykać„Polecenie utworzenia pliku w lokalnym repozytorium GIT:
$ Touch File2.tekstKrok 3: Śledź plik lokalny
Następnie śledź obszar inscenizacji git za pomocą „Git dodaj”Polecenie wraz z nazwą pliku:
$ git dodaj plik2.tekstKrok 4: Repozytorium aktualizacji
Uruchom „git zatwierdzić„Polecenie z„-M„Opcja popełnienia zmian i dodania żądanego komunikatu zatwierdzenia:
$ git commit -m "Dewnd Plik dodane"Krok 5: Sprawdź historię dziennika referencyjnego git
Aby sprawdzić historię dziennika referencyjnego GIT, uruchom „Git Log ." Komenda:
$ git log .Krok 6: Wymień zdalny adres URL
Uruchom „git pilot„Polecenie z„-v„Opcja wyświetlania listy istniejących zdalnych adresów URL:
$ git pilot -vKrok 7: Git Fetch
Następnie pobieraj zaktualizowane zdalne repozytorium za pomocą „Git Fetch" Komenda:
$ git fetchKrok 8: GIT Resetuj lokalne repozytorium
Na koniec wykonaj „Git Reset„Polecenie z„-twardy”Opcja i wymień„Origin/Master„Aby zresetować lokalne repozytorium:
$ git reset -hard pochodzenie/mistrzKrok 9: Sprawdź resetuj lokalne repozytorium
Wreszcie, aby zweryfikować lokalne repozytorium resetowania, uruchom „Git Log ." Komenda:
$ git log .Opisaliśmy znaczenie „Git Reset -Hard Origin/Master”I jak go używać.
Wniosek
„„Git Reset„Polecenie z„-twardy„Opcja wraz z„Origin/Master”Służy do inscenizowanych i niezbadanych zmian, usuń wszystkie dokonane zmiany w bieżącej gałęzi lokalnej i uczynić ją tak samo jak Origin/Master. Aby użyć tego polecenia, najpierw przejdź do repozytorium i utwórz nowy plik, śledź go w obszarze inscenizacji i poprowadź zmiany. Następnie sprawdź historię dziennika i wyświetl listę istniejących zdalnych adresów URL. Następnie pobierz zaktualizowaną kopię zdalnego repozytorium i uruchom „$ git reset -Hard pochodzenie/master" Komenda. Ten post wyjaśnił, jak „Git Reset -Hard Origin/Master" Pracuje.